VIEW MORE PHOTOS A year-long cleanup of Swift Camp Creek, which is a tributary of the Red River, is complete. Trash pulled from the creek added up to 27 pickup-truck loads with 60 to 70 bags each, 10 dump-truck loads of 3 to 3.5 tons each, and 230 tires. County workers and inmates spent […]
